Here is the chart for height/weight. Height Male: Female: 58 Inches 91+ Pounds 91-123 Pounds 59 Inches 94+ Pounds 94-128 Pounds 60 Inches 97-141 Pounds 97-133 Pounds 61 Inches 100-146 Pounds 100-137 Pounds 62 Inches 103-150 Pounds 104-142 Pounds 63 Inches 107-155 Pounds 107-146 Pounds 64 Inches 110-160 Pounds 110-151 Pounds 65 Inches 114-165 Pounds 114-156 Pounds 66 Inches 117-170 Pounds 117-161 Pounds 67 Inches 121-176 Pounds 121-166 Pounds 68 Inches 125-181 Pounds 125-171 Pounds 69 Inches 128-186 Pounds 128-176 Pounds 70 Inches 132-192 Pounds 132-181 Pounds 71 Inches 136-197 Pounds 136-186 Pounds 72 Inches 140-203 Pounds 140-191 Pounds 73 Inches 144-208 Pounds 144-197 Pounds 74 Inches 148-214 Pounds 148-202 Pounds 75 Inches 152-220 Pounds 152-208 Pounds 76 Inches 156-226 Pounds 156-213 Pounds 77 Inches 160-232 Pounds 160-219 Pounds 78 Inches 164-238 Pounds 164-225 Pounds 79 Inches 168-244 Pounds 168-230 Pounds 80 Inches 173-250 Pounds 173-236 Pounds
